A prominent journalist doesn't just want our air conditioners turned down. He wants them off. This is the sort of nonsense we're getting from the anti-energy, global-warming-is-making-us-sick left.
Time's Joe Klein probably thought he was being clever when he wrote his late June essay on the evils of cooling headlined "Kill Your Air Conditioner." Instead, he wrote yet another chapter in the left's book of environmental silliness.
"The unnecessary refrigeration of America has become a chronic disease," said Klein. "Air conditioning is bad for the planet, and for national security, and for our balance-of-payments deficit."

Air conditioning and refrigeration are probably the biggest advance in human medicine and quality of life after indoor plumbing/sanitation. Air conditioning making the siesta a luxury, and refrigeration making food poisoning a rare occurrence.
